>>>>>>>>>>> Hi Uma,
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> What is the roadmap for the next release?
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>  It has been requested several times after the new releases to
>>>>>>>>>>> have a plan for the next version.
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> It is better if we were towards defined objectives. I feel the
>>>>>>>>>>> next version must be focused towards Library updates and introducing
>>>>>>>>>>> composer, solely.
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> Bootstrap, PHPMailer, Jquery, Select2 must be upgraded if
>>>>>>>>>>> nothing. I understand there are dependencies on jQuery, which you have
>>>>>>>>>>> mentioned earlier. But I feel then we should replace those dependencies, if
>>>>>>>>>>> they are not actively maintained!
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> We have many patches and new features ready to be merged with
>>>>>>>>>>> Open Source but without a clear roadmap at least for the next version, that
>>>>>>>>>>> becomes a speed breaker.

>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> I agree with Ruben. Even though support for php7.2 will be
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> ending this year.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Recommended is PHP 7.4 but from a simple phostan analysis,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the code base has some very old code (PHP 4...).
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Il mar 20 lug 2021, 19:44 Rubén A. Estrada Orozco <
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> rulotec1 at gmail.com> ha scritto:
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> But the manual says: PHP 5.2+, 7.2+
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> What does that even mean? Does it mean it's ok to use php
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> 52 with vtiger 7.4? I really don't think that would work.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Does it mean I can use php 7.4 or even 8?
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> I feel those requirements should be vtiger-version specific.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Furthermore, we cannot expect the average user to somehow
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> find that manual. I think it should be clearly stated in the installation
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> process in Vtiger and not be ambiguous as it currently is.
